
Kennedy And His Family In Pictures - Special Edition by LOOK
This is a vintage softcover memorial book titled 'Kennedy And His Family In Pictures,' published by the editors of LOOK magazine. The cover features a candid, color photograph of President John F. Kennedy smiling at his young son, John F. Kennedy Jr., set against a background of lush green foliage. The publication was released shortly after the President's assassination in late 1963, originally retailing for 'ONE DOLLAR.' The layout features prominent gold serif typography for the word 'KENNEDY' and black text for the subtitle. Physically, the item appears to be an oversized magazine or soft-bound commemorative album printed on semi-gloss paper stock. Regarding condition, the cover shows visible signs of age and wear including minor creasing at the top left and bottom corners, slight yellowing of the white margins (patina), and some surface scuffing near the top edge. The binding appears intact but shows evidence of handling. As a piece of Kennedy Americana, it reflects the high-quality photojournalism style characteristic of LOOK magazine in the early 1960s, designed as a collectible tribute for a mourning public.
